What sets a VIP transfer apart
When you post a request and mark it VIP, only drivers with vehicles registered in that category can bid. That means no downgrade surprises: the van that shows up is the one you were quoted, inspected and insured to Turkish commercial passenger-transport standards.
Typical touches drivers in this category offer:
- A printed or digital name board at arrivals, plus a WhatsApp message with the driver's photo and plate number in advance
- Bottled water and phone chargers on board
- Quiet, air-conditioned cabins suited to sleeping children or a laptop-open business call
- Flexible short stops en route (a supermarket, a currency exchange) arranged directly through in-app messaging
Typical routes and starting prices
Antalion's live-bid pricing means a VIP transfer isn't automatically the most expensive option — it's simply the vehicle class you're guaranteed. Based on roughly €1 per kilometre as a rough baseline before drivers undercut each other:
- Antalya Airport → Lara/city hotels (~12 km): from around €20–28
- Antalya Airport → Belek (~35 km): from around €45–60
- Antalya Airport → Kemer (~45 km): from around €55–70
- Antalya Airport → Side (~65 km): from around €70–90
Final prices are set by live competitive bidding, not a fixed rate card — request your route to see current offers for your date and vehicle size.

Booking and paying
As with every Antalion transfer, you never hand over cash or a card in the vehicle. The agreed price is paid to Antalion online in advance, and the driver receives their share afterwards — this keeps the transaction transparent for both sides and avoids any awkward negotiation at the roadside.
